The living room walls in your home are begging to be used; however, you find the project a bit intimidating. You don’t want to keep staring at blank walls, but you aren’t sure where to begin. Here are some ideas to maximize your living room wall space.
Start With Some Paint
Painting your living room walls is an easy way to bring life into the room without an enormous commitment. Painting is inexpensive and when you want a new look, repaint.
Start by collecting paint cards. Some places may even offer paint samples to try. If you are still stuck on color choices, the color wheel is the place to go for inspiration. You may find a color combination you weren’t even considering.
Set Up Mirrors
Mirrors serve a multipurpose in a living room. First, they bounce natural light back into space. The living room will seem brighter and more inviting without using a lot of harsh lighting. Second, mirrors make smaller spaces appear large.
For a smaller room, just a few mirrors will do the trick. For a large wall, oversized mirrors will be perfect. To truly make a statement, consider covering an entire wall with mirrors. Mix and match for a dramatic effect.
Create a Gallery Wall
To create a focal point in your living room, transform a wall into a gallery. The best part is you don’t need to have a fine art collection at your disposal. Consider using family photos, the children’s artwork, a map collection, or anything else you want.
Maybe you have some prints you want to use. A custom picture framing service will be the place to start. They will help you find picture frames that complement your pictures and living room.
Use Wallpaper to Create a Feature Wall
Want to breathe some life into your living room? Or do you have a wall that would make for an ideal feature wall? Now is the time to use a bold and brilliant design to create a unique area.
You may want to take some time to live with some sample wallpaper pieces. The wallpaper may seem perfect at the moment. However, you may not feel that way two weeks later. Have fun and experiment with designs and patterns.
